Route 12 (Japanese: 12番道路 Route 12) is a route on Alola's Ula'ula Island, connecting Route 11, Route 13, Blush Mountain, and Secluded Shore.
Route description
Items
All items on this route require Mudsdale Gallop.
Item | Location | Games | |
---|---|---|---|
Mudsdale Gallop | From Hapu upon visiting the route for the first time | S M | |
Burn Heal | Above a rock south of the first rough terrain | S M | |
Elixir | Below Rising Star Leilani | S M | |
Hyper Potion | East of Rising Star Matthew | S M | |
X Attack | Below Scientist Jayson | S M | |
PP Up | In front of a rock in the southern most part (hidden) | S M | |
TM77 (Psych Up) | From Collector Andrew for defeating him | S M | |
